1. Ideal Weather Conditions for Painting


Selecting the right time for painting your home's exterior can significantly impact the outcome. Fall offers cooler temperatures that are ideal for various types of paint, ensuring a flawless finish.


Optimal Temperature Ranges:


  • Latex Paint: Best applied when temperatures range above 40 degrees. These temperature ranges ensure that the paint dries evenly and adheres properly to surfaces.
  • Benefits of Cooler Weather: Cooler fall temperatures enhance paint adhesion and durability. Paint applied under these conditions tends to bond more effectively with the surface, providing a long-lasting finish. This is especially crucial in areas like Colorado Springs, where weather conditions fluctuate greatly.
  • Reducing Risks: Fall’s moderate temperatures help reduce the risk of bubbling or peeling. When not applied correctly, high summer heat can cause paint to dry too quickly, trapping moisture underneath and leading to unsightly bubbles. Similarly, extremely cold weather can prevent paint from curing properly, increasing the likelihood of peeling.


By choosing fall for your exterior painting project, you leverage the season's temperate conditions to achieve a superior finish. This makes fall an excellent time to refresh your home's exterior with confidence and precision.


2. Low Humidity Levels


Low humidity is crucial for achieving a consistent and flawless drying process for outdoor paint. When the air is moist, it can interfere with how paint sticks to surfaces, resulting in imperfections like streaks and uneven textures. During the fall, the air tends to be drier, creating ideal conditions for painting.

The Impact of Humidity on Paint Application and Finish Quality


Here's how high humidity can negatively affect your painting project:


  • Uneven Drying: High humidity can cause paint to dry unevenly, resulting in blotchy finishes.
  • Adhesion Issues: Moisture-laden air can prevent paint from adhering properly to surfaces, potentially causing peeling or bubbling.
  • Extended Drying Times: High humidity prolongs the drying process, leaving paint susceptible to dust, debris, and insects.


Advantages of Lower Humidity During Fall


On the other hand, lower humidity during fall brings several benefits for your painting project:


  • Smooth Finish: Crisp autumn air helps achieve a uniformly smooth finish, enhancing the aesthetics of your home’s exterior.
  • Better Adhesion: Dry conditions ensure that paint adheres more effectively, reducing the risk of future peeling or chipping.
  • Faster Drying: With quicker drying times, projects can be completed more efficiently without compromising quality.


How Proper Drying Conditions Extend the Life of Exterior Paint


Proper drying conditions contribute significantly to the longevity of paint. When paint cures correctly under low humidity:


  • Increased Durability: The paint forms a stronger bond with the surface, making it more resilient against environmental stresses.
  • Enhanced Protection: A well-dried coat offers better protection against rain, wind, and other elements.
  • Long-lasting Results: By minimizing defects during application, low humidity ensures that your exterior paint job stands the test of time.


Taking advantage of fall’s lower humidity levels not only guarantees a beautiful finish but also extends the lifespan of your exterior paint.

3. Reduced Insect Activity


Fall brings a natural decline in insect activity, which plays a significant role in creating an efficient painting process. During the warmer months, insects like flies, mosquitoes, and gnats are in full force, often leading to interruptions and imperfections in the paint job.


When these pests land on wet paint, they can create unsightly marks and require additional touch-ups.

5. Preparation for Winter Weather


Applying a protective layer to your home's exterior before winter is crucial. Snow and ice can cause significant damage, but a fresh coat of paint acts as a barrier, safeguarding the underlying materials.


Timely exterior painting helps in moisture damage prevention. During colder months, untreated surfaces can absorb moisture, leading to issues like mold, mildew, and wood rot. A well-applied paint job seals cracks and gaps, keeping moisture out and preserving the integrity of your home.


Consider the impact on curb appeal if you're thinking about selling your home. A newly painted exterior not only looks appealing but also signals to potential buyers that the property has been well-maintained. This small investment can significantly increase your home's market value.


Don't forget about the fascia and trim. Fixing these areas before winter reduces further water damage during freeze-thaw cycles. Ensuring these elements are in top shape prevents costly repairs down the line.


By preparing now, homeowners set their properties up for success through harsh winter conditions, maintaining both aesthetic appeal and structural integrity.
